I built this Land Cruiser out as my long distance tourer not that long ago, however, sadly I'm moving out of the states for a while for work.

This Landcruiser is registered in California, recently smogged.
Its currently located in Las Vegas though, since I had to fly out when I was in that area. I can drive it to LA area though to show in person.

- Toyota Landcruiser 2000 195K CA vehicle zero rust. Black outside, Tan inside.
Drives like new, really strong.The only "bad" is the typical Landcruiser D-N-R clunk when switching between these gears.
All OEM filters and the best Oils. Recent passive AT flush with Amsoil ATF. Comes with extra 5 Gal. Of Amsoil ATF.
Interior is clean, no cracks, AC blows super cold, everything electrical works.

- 2000 miles on 5 new General Grabbers AT/x (3 months old)
- Prinsu Roof Rack

- Ikamper Skyroam 2x 4 person (All Ikamper stuff is 3 months old, used for a week or so out camping)
- Ikamper Annex + 2 Ikamper hanging Shoebags
(Incredible RTT, it sets up in minutes. Hardly feel it's on the roof while driving.and the King size bed area is hard to beat. I'm 6,4, so the extra space has been great.)

- ARB twin compressor + ARB In/Deflator
- Optima Yellow Top 2nd Battery
- Slee 2nd Battery tray.
- ARB Classic series 2, 2019 model Fridge. 55 quart Fridge with Bluetooth
- ARB Tred Pro's 2x
- 2x NEMO Stairgazer Chairs (like laying in bed, so comfortable)
- 1500 Watt Inverter
- Redarc BCDC 1225 Charger
- Adler Hatchet
- Cooking stove Coleman Triton
- Cooking ware and 2 light weight aluminum foldable tables.
- Foldable shuffle
- Hi lift Jack

Lots of little things like a bluetooth OBD2 scanner that works great with the Torque App, propane canisters, a tarp, extra awning poles etc.

No front or rear bumper.. I was going to drive "around the world" with this set up, many countries don't allow for the bumpers.

And the suspension is stock. I haven't had the need for a lift. The tires are 295's which is a great size and if you know how to wheel, where to place the tires it's no issue at all. I've done part of the Rubicon, long rocky stretches in Utah and the Eastern Sierras. Never any issues with clearance.
